	"description": "Ever wondered how states pay for affordable housing? Join DSA’s House the Future campaign to learn how New York’s housing system is currently financed, how the social housing model is different, and why that matters for how we envision the future of housing in New York State. This session will be an interactive discussion of the basic principles of housing finance, including the differences between our current affordable housing model and the social housing model that we’re fighting for. Whether you’re curious how affordable homes get built today or you want to learn what you can do to fix our broken housing system, we want to hear your ideas and experiences.",
